Special interest holidays:
Madeira is also a paradise for hikers. Even with difficult routes, you will rarely ever reach a full sweat because of the moderate climate. The most popular hiking-routes are the supply-routes along the artificial irrigation canals (levadas) that cover 2100 km on the island and lead to all sights worth seeing. Many varied and new routes make this classical nature experience very attractive to people young and old. For those who prefer 'a somewhat harder' pace, you can decide to trek the breath-robbing stunning mountain paths selected by the experts.
Golf:
Golf Information: For the golfers, the island has two wonderful championship courses - In Santo, the Sierra course with 27 holes, is the home to the Madeira Iceland Open Championship organized by the PGA Europe. And Palheiro (18 holes) offers a wonderful view of the bay of Funchal.
